AWS IoT: scopri i servizi Internet delle cose da Amazon Web Services

Quando un'azienda lavora a un progetto IoT, il suo team deve occuparsi di molti dispositivi, strumenti e specifiche di sicurezza. È qui che entrano in gioco le piattaforme IoT, che consentono il monitoraggio dell'archiviazione dei dati, la comunicazione, la sicurezza e la collaborazione tra diversi team.

Quando un'azienda lavora a un progetto IoT, il suo team deve occuparsi di molti dispositivi, strumenti e specifiche di sicurezza. È qui che entrano in gioco le piattaforme IoT, che consentono il monitoraggio dell'archiviazione dei dati, la comunicazione, la sicurezza e la collaborazione tra diversi team.

Il leader innegabile tra le piattaforme IoT è Amazon AWS IoT Services, un servizio cloud progettato specificamente per lo sviluppo di software IoT e supportato da Amazon Web Services. In questo articolo, esamineremo le caratteristiche principali della piattaforma, i suoi vantaggi e alcuni casi d'uso.

Cosa sono i servizi AWS IoT?

AWS IoT Services è una piattaforma cloud che funziona con migliaia di dispositivi connessi ed è in grado di elaborare trilioni di richieste contemporaneamente. Per archiviare i file di comunicazione e abilitare le funzionalità, AWS IoT Services fornisce un'infrastruttura cloud: le informazioni vengono archiviate sui server Amazon Web Services.

Quali soluzioni può offrire AWS IoT per i dispositivi IoT?

La piattaforma Amazon Internet of Things collega fondamentalmente i dispositivi IoT al cloud. Ogni dispositivo trasferisce le sue informazioni all'ombra del dispositivo. Il servizio ombra risponderà alle richieste e lavorerà con la funzionalità dell'applicazione.

I certificati X.509 ingegnerizzano le comunicazioni tra il dispositivo reale e il suo servizio ombra. Questa è un'idea di base alla base della piattaforma AWS IoT: diamo un'occhiata alle sue soluzioni chiave.

  • Gestione dei dispositivi IoT: un servizio che consente di registrare, organizzare, proteggere, monitorare e gestire dispositivi e sensori collegati da remoto. Il servizio fornisce statistiche in tempo reale sulle prestazioni dell'applicazione e consente il caricamento da più dispositivi contemporaneamente.
  • Dispositivo di protezione IoT: La piattaforma Amazon IoT garantisce che i report sulla sicurezza del cloud AWS vengano raccolti da tutti i dispositivi connessi: questi parametri vengono inviati a Device Defender, che verifica se i parametri mostrano anomalie. Se si verifica uno strano tentativo di accesso o un comportamento innaturale, Defender aggiorna AWS Cloud Watch, la console IoT e Device Management.
  • AWSLambda: un ambiente di sviluppo software in cui gli sviluppatori possono scrivere e modificare codice, aggregare progetti da altri servizi AWS (incluso IoT) ed eseguire codice una volta scritto. È una piattaforma per l'implementazione continua: gli sviluppatori possono rilasciare il codice al servizio uno alla volta, evitando debiti tecnologici e disordine di bug.
  • AWS IoT Greengrass: i dispositivi fisici che generano informazioni (attrezzature, trasporti, ecc.) sono collegati a Greengrass Connectors. I dati dai connettori vengono inviati a Lambda e le ombre dei dispositivi da Greengrass Core. È così che i dati dal mondo esterno arrivano nel software.
  • Analisi AWS IoT: il servizio crea analisi dai dati IoT. È responsabile della raccolta, dell'elaborazione, dell'archiviazione, dell'analisi dell'apprendimento automatico in tempo reale e del reporting basato sul codice.

Quali servizi sono inclusi in IoT AWS?

AWS IoT Services è un'ambiziosa piattaforma di gestione IoT con dozzine di funzionalità. Se dovessimo concentrarci sulla piena funzionalità, leggeresti un ebook di 40 pagine in questo momento. Per mantenere la guida breve, abbiamo evidenziato i servizi AWS IoT essenziali che sono essenziali per la maggior parte dei progetti IoT.

  • Gateway del dispositivo: tutti i dispositivi su Amazon Web Services per IoT sono connessi al gateway. Il servizio è responsabile del mantenimento delle connessioni tra i dispositivi e un server anche in condizioni di bassa latenza. Device Gateway è il gateway per utilizzare la piattaforma AWS IoT.
  • Agente di messaggistica: questo servizio consente ai dispositivi collegati di scambiare messaggi tra loro e con un server delle applicazioni. Questo strumento è responsabile della connettività: può elaborare, archiviare e organizzare migliaia di messaggi contemporaneamente.
  • Ombra del dispositivo: tutti i dispositivi AWS IoT sulla piattaforma AWS IoT hanno una versione virtuale, un'ombra. Memorizza informazioni sullo stato delle apparecchiature fisiche a cui è possibile accedere da remoto. Qui puoi impostare i parametri delle prestazioni per i dispositivi IoT e persino pianificare le impostazioni con un anno di anticipo.
  • Motore di regole: questo strumento pone restrizioni e applica linee guida sull'utilizzo dei dati. La regola definisce come i dispositivi elaborano i dati. Ad esempio, puoi specificare una soglia e impostare un valore predefinito per i valori al di sopra della soglia. Le regole AWS IoT attiveranno l'esecuzione di alcune funzionalità AWS Lambda, collegando gli aggiornamenti hardware con le reazioni software.

Lo scopo principale dei servizi Amazon e IoT è connettere il codice hardware e software IoT. La piattaforma crea un ambiente per lo scambio, l'organizzazione e la gestione dei dati sicuri. Le modifiche allo stato del dispositivo vengono salvate nel sistema, dove le regole possono attivare le modifiche al codice.

Quali vantaggi offre la piattaforma AWS IoT per le aziende?

La piattaforma AWS IoT rende più veloce lo sviluppo IoT: il codice è disponibile in AWS Lambda dove può essere eseguito immediatamente, l'hardware è gestito nell'ombra, ecc. Questo non è l'unico vantaggio: molti vantaggi entrano in gioco dopo il lancio di un prodotto.

  • Gestione dei dispositivi: le soluzioni responsabili della gestione dei dispositivi, dell'organizzazione dei dati e dell'integrazione nel cloud consentono agli sviluppatori e ai project manager di tenere facilmente traccia delle modifiche ai prodotti.
  • Sicurezza dei dati e sicurezza della connessione: AWS dispone di rigorosi algoritmi di controllo degli accessi: puoi configurare l'autenticazione in più passaggi e definire i ruoli utente. Il sistema monitora continuamente le prestazioni del software e rileva schemi sospetti. Riceverai un avviso se qualcosa sembra insolito.
  • Elaborazione dei dati migliorata: la piattaforma Amazon IoT utilizza l'IA per configurare i modelli di elaborazione e archiviazione dei dati. È possibile configurare scenari che verranno eseguiti automaticamente nel cloud. L'elaborazione dei dati può migliorare la tua efficienza e velocità con i componenti aggiuntivi di Machine Learning.
  • Dimensionamento dei progetti IoT: AWS IoT è connesso a un'infrastruttura produttiva da Amazon Web Services. Il servizio funziona insieme a servizi robusti, che ti consentono di aggiungere nuove funzionalità. Se desideri aggiungere il machine learning al tuo IoT, utilizza Amazon SageMaker. Per aumentare lo spazio di archiviazione dei dati, hai Amazon S3. Il fatto che la piattaforma Amazon IoT faccia parte di un'infrastruttura significativa è un vantaggio in quanto non sarà necessario migrare a un altro servizio per aggiungere una nuova funzionalità.

Vuoi esplorare le funzionalità della piattaforma AWS IoT? parla con noi adesso e scopri come possiamo aiutarti a implementarlo nella tua attività!

Condividi